4. 查看虚拟网卡

执行命令busybox ifconfig,可以看到生成了ppp0网口,如下:

但是此时是无法连接互联网的,因为没有配置dns

5. 查看dns

首先看下通过pppoe报文交互获得dns是什么,利用命令获取如下:getprop | grep dns

[net.-ppp0.dns1]: [211.136.20.203] [net.-ppp0.dns2]: [211.136.17.107] 6. 配置dsn root@petrel-p1:/system/etc/ppp # setprop net.dns1 211.136.20.203 root@petrel-p1:/system/etc/ppp # setprop net.dns2 211.136.17.107 root@petrel-p1:/system/etc/ppp # ndc resolver setifdns ppp0 “” 211.136.20.203 200 0 Resolver command succeeded root@petrel-p1:/system/etc/ppp # ndc resolver setdefaultif ppp0 7. ping百度
